Abstract

Some of the factors that may influence the reliability of a consistent material balance derived from plant data were investigated, data taken from a sampling of the Iow-grade tin-flotation circuit at Rooiberg A Mine being used as the basis for the investigation. The importance of subjecting a calculated balance to a thorough analysis of its sensitivity to erors in assay and flow rate measurements is highlighted. Several simple guidelines are derived from the analysis of the Rooiberg data, and these appear to be generaly applicable to process-evaluation exercises and to the technique used for the smoothing of material balances.
